Jonathan Meadows named Insurance Litigator of the Year by Benchmark Canada® 2020

June 15, 2020

We are proud to announce that Harper Grey’s Managing Partner, Jonathan Meadows, has been named Insurance Litigator of the Year by Benchmark Canada® 2020.

With over 20 years of dispute resolution experience, Jonathan enjoys a busy broad based civil litigation practice. His practice includes working on behalf of insurers, representing directors and officers and companies with respect to coverage issues, advising and assisting physicians in professional liability and disciplinary matters and representing both plaintiffs and defendants in a broad range of multi-party cases and class actions. In 2019 his strong leadership skills were leveraged as he stepped into the role of Managing Partner.

“Juggling the responsibilities of Managing Partner while maintaining a busy practice is no easy feat – but it’s one that Jonathan continues to succeed at,” says Harper Grey partner and Insurance Group Chair Nigel Trevethan. “Jonathan is known for bringing a well-rounded perspective to each of his files – something that is appreciated by both his clients and colleagues alike. We are extremely proud to have him recognized as Insurance Litigator of the Year. From all of us at Harper Grey, congratulations Jonathan!”

The Benchmark Canada awards honour top lawyers and firms from across the country for their exceptional work throughout the past year. The methodology employed by Benchmark to determine the award recipients includes extensive research, peer reviews and interviews with litigators and their clients. Shortlists and award recipients are derived from concurrent research conducted for the 2020 edition of Benchmark Canada during the last three months of 2019.
